by friarsol » 04 Jul 2011, 02:31
I found a way to determine if images are corrupt. It seems to me that a lot of the files I've downloaded recently aren't correct, so reuploading should probably fix that.
If you are interested in the python script you need to download the Python Imaging Library (http://www.pythonware.com/products/pil/) and then run this:
If you are interested in the python script you need to download the Python Imaging Library (http://www.pythonware.com/products/pil/) and then run this:
- Code: Select all
from PIL import Image
import os,fnmatch
err = open('imageVerify.log','w')
for root, dirnames, filenames in os.walk("."):
for fileName in fnmatch.filter(filenames, '*.jpg'):
if fileName.startswith('.'):
continue
path = os.path.join(root, fileName)
try:
im = Image.open(path)
im.verify()
except Exception:
print path
err.write(path + '\n')
